Selling my 93 Isuzu Bighorn Handling By Lotus w/ the 3.1 diesel engine (4JG2). Has ~90,000 km/~56000mi. Was going to post on BAT OR cars and bids but they only will list it for no reserve. The fuel adjustment cap is still on so it's never been touched. EGR delete and the addition of gauges are the only mods to the engine. Oil was changed about 4500 mi ago with Amsoil Signature Series Max-Duty Synthetic Diesel. Always use that or Shell T-6.

I really love this car, this is my second Bighorn. All of the parts came from my last Bighorn so things like the rims are beat up from that. Towed my boat and this car really struggled. I decided to buy an 80 series to get more power and room. I like this more than the land curser just doesn't have enough power for me.
